The AD5274BRMZ-100 belongs to the category of digital potentiometers.
It is primarily used for electronic circuitry and system calibration, as well as in various applications requiring variable resistance.
The AD5274BRMZ-100 comes in a small form factor package, specifically a 10-lead MSOP (Mini Small Outline Package).
The essence of the AD5274BRMZ-100 lies in its ability to provide precise and programmable resistance values in electronic circuits.

The AD5274BRMZ-100 operates by digitally controlling the resistance value between its terminal A (RH) and terminal B (RL). The desired resistance is set using the I2C-compatible interface, which sends commands to the digital potentiometer. The non-volatile memory ensures that the resistance setting is retained even when power is removed.
